The Career Advancement Programme in Pet Welfare Ethics showcases a variety of rewarding roles for animal lovers seeking to make a positive impact on the well-being of pets and other animals.
Let's delve into the details of each role and its respective job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and. 1.
Pet Welfare Officer: As a Pet Welfare Officer, you will develop, implement, and monitor policies concerning animal welfare in various settings.
With a 30% share of the industry, you will work closely with local authorities, veterinary practices, and animal charities to ensure compliance with animal welfare laws and regulations.
Salary range: Β£20,000 - Β£35,000 per annum 2.
Animal Care Technician: Animal Care Technicians work in a supervisory capacity in animal shelters, kennels, or veterinary clinics.
They provide specialized care for animals and monitor their health, nutrition, and behavior.
This role accounts for 25% of the industry.
Salary range: Β£16,000 - Β£25,000 per annum 3.
Veterinary Assistant: A Veterinary Assistant supports veterinarians and veterinary nurses in caring for animals, monitoring their health, and maintaining records.
This role represents 20% of the industry.
Salary range: Β£15,000 - Β£24,000 per annum 4.
Pet Behavioral Therapist: Pet Behavioral Therapists assess, diagnose, and treat pets with behavioral issues.
This role comprises 15% of the industry, offering opportunities to work with various animals and their owners.
Salary range: Β£20,000 - Β£40,000 per annum 5.
Pet Nutrition Consultant: Pet Nutrition Consultants provide tailored dietary recommendations for pets based on their breed, age, health status, and lifestyle.
This 10% share role offers a unique opportunity to improve the quality of life for pets and educate their owners about proper nutrition.
Salary range: Β£25,000 - Β£50,000 per annum
